I punched out a 3/4" circle of cardstock, then fixed the slightly curved petals to the circle with Crystal Effects. I let the flowers dry overnight, then the next day, I used a fine paintbrush handle to curve them better. I adhered them to the card with a stampin dimensional. The curved petals are pushed out (more 3-D) when the dimensional is pressed upon to ensure it is stuck to the card. Hope this helps!
